Thrombolytic drugs are medications that are used to dissolve blood clots in patients who are at risk of serious complications due to blockages in blood vessels.

Key Features

  • Clot-dissolving properties
  • Helps restore blood flow
  • Used in conditions like heart attacks and strokes

Pros

  • Effective in treating acute conditions like heart attacks and strokes
  • Can help prevent long-term damage from blood clots

Cons

  • Risk of bleeding as a side effect
  • May not be suitable for all patients, depending on their medical history
